| Riassunto: | It is a critical study rather than an anthology, but it contains many poems [some 300], all translated with unmistakable care ... As Brower and Miner have demonstrated in this epoch making book, the achievement of Japanese court poetry within its deliberately restricted domain is impressive. It deserves this long-awaited attention. |
